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
PHP-FPMのコンテナログ2重出力問題
Search
NIIKURA Ryota
March 01, 2018
Technology
0
190
PHP-FPMのコンテナログ2重出力問題
まだ答えが出ていないネタですが、同じような悩みを持った人がいないかなぁと思ってとりあえず上げてみました。
進展があったらまた発表しようと思います
NIIKURA Ryota
March 01, 2018
Tweet
Share
More Decks by NIIKURA Ryota
See All by NIIKURA Ryota
SwooleでLaravelを高速化してみる
niisantokyo
0
4.2k
新人さんでもテストを書くべきだっていう話
niisantokyo
1
770
一次元畳み込みフィルターによる音声データのオートエンコーダ
niisantokyo
1
2.8k
タグ付けデプロイの話
niisantokyo
1
930
TensorFlow.jsに保存機能が実装された件
niisantokyo
1
260
Laradockの紹介
niisantokyo
0
940
deeplearnjsの紹介
niisantokyo
1
210
ひたすら楽して、PHPアプリをコンテナ運用の縮小版
niisantokyo
0
760
PHPでニューラルネットを作った話
niisantokyo
2
3.8k
Other Decks in Technology
See All in Technology
私が trocco を推す理由
__allllllllez__
1
210
推しは推せるときに推せ! プロダクトにフィードバックしていこう
nakasho
0
290
日本におけるデータエンジニアリングのこれまでとこれから
foursue
16
4.2k
テストプロセスで大事にしていること #jasstnano
makky_tyuyan
0
160
プロトタイピングによる不確実性の低減 / Reducing Uncertainty through Prototyping
ohbarye
5
380
MapLibreとAmazon Location Service
dayjournal
1
150
Janus
bkuhlmann
1
490
VS CodeでAWSを操作しよう
smt7174
7
1.6k
ServiceNow Knowledge 24の歩き方 EYストラテジー・アンド・コンサルティング
manarobot
0
190
反実仮想機械学習とは何か
usaito
PRO
11
4.2k
地理空間データ可視化・解析・活用ソリューション Pacific Spatial Solutions (PSS)
pacificspatialsolutions
0
140
AWSに詳しくない人でも始められるコスト最適化ガイド
yuhta28
0
170
Featured
See All Featured
The Psychology of Web Performance [Beyond Tellerrand 2023]
tammyeverts
6
1.5k
What’s in a name? Adding method to the madness
productmarketing
PRO
16
2.6k
No one is an island. Learnings from fostering a developers community.
thoeni
16
2.1k
The Invisible Customer
myddelton
114
12k
A Philosophy of Restraint
colly
197
16k
Robots, Beer and Maslow
schacon
PRO
155
7.9k
Debugging Ruby Performance
tmm1
70
11k
ParisWeb 2013: Learning to Love: Crash Course in Emotional UX Design
dotmariusz
104
6.6k
Being A Developer After 40
akosma
57
580k
Happy Clients
brianwarren
92
6.4k
Web Components: a chance to create the future
zenorocha
305
41k
Teambox: Starting and Learning
jrom
128
8.4k
Transcript
1)1'1.ͷίϯςφϩά͕ ॏग़ྗ͞ΕΔ ୈճ1)1ษڧձ!(.0:PVST ৽ྋଠ
ϫλγ w ΤϯδχΞྺ͘Β͍ w ΤϯδχΞྺ1)1FSྺ w ݱ৬ྺؙ w ٿӴ܉ͰϨϯδϟʔ ΛᅂΉ
w ϓϩάϥϜΛॻ͍͍ͯΔͱػݏ͕ྑ͘ͳΔ w ภ৯ w ݩࣄ
ϚΠϒʔϜ Իָ࡞"*࡞ΔΜͩͲΜ IUUQTHJUIVCDPNOJJTBOUPLZPNVTJD@HFOFSBUPS ·͊ɺ1ZUIPO͚ͩͲɻɻɻ
ࠓճɺ·ͩࣗͷதͰ͕͑ ग़͍ͯͳ͍Ͱ͢ɻ ຊʹਃ͠༁ͳ͍
ίϯςφͰಈ͘ΞϓϦͷ ϩάͲ͏࠾औ͢Δ͔
5IF5XFMWF'BDUPS"QQ ϩάͷ෦ൈਮ ίϯςφͷӡ༻Ͱɺ͜ͷߟ͑Λ࠾༻͍ͯ͠Δ߹͕ଟ͍
$MPVE8BUDI-PHT $MPVE8BUDI-PHT&$4ͷίϯςφͷඪ४ग़ྗʹྲྀΕΔ ϩάΛ࠾औͯ͘͠ΕΔ ίϯςφ ඪ४ग़ྗ ඪ४Τϥʔ $MPVE8BUDI
ͭ·Γɺඪ४ग़ྗʹϩάΛग़ ͤΑ͍ͷͩʂ खͬऔΓૣ͘ඪ ४ग़ྗʹग़͢
·͋ɺ͜͏ͳΓ·͢Θ IUUQMPDBMIPTU વ͚ͩͲɺඪ४ग़ྗʹग़ͨΒɺϢʔβʔͷϏϡʔ ʹදࣔ͞Εͯ͠·͏
ඪ४ΤϥʔΛ͏ Τϥʔϩάʹϝοηʔ δΛग़ͨ͠
0, IUUQMPDBMIPTU ԿΒ͚ͩͲɺGQNͷΤϥʔϩάʹग़ྗ͞Ε͍ͯΔʂ
ͱ͜ΖͰɺ'1.Λ͏ͱ͖ OHJOY 1)1'1. جຊతʹ'1.୯ಠͰͳ͘ɺ"QBDIFͳΓ/HJOYͳΓ ͷϓϩΩγΛ͔·͢ ͦΕͧΕʹରͯ͠ϩάΛऔ͍ͬͯΔΘ͚͕ͩ
OHJOYͷΤϥʔϩά OHJOYͷΤϥʔϩάʹɺ'1.ͷΤϥʔϩάͷ༰͕ग़ྗ ͞Ε͍ͯΔʂʂʂ
͜Ε͕ϫλγΛ·͢ ॏϩά
w '1.ͷϩάඪ४Τϥʔʹग़͢͜ͱʹͳΔ w '1.ͷඪ४Τϥʔ$MPVE8BUDI͚ͩͰͳ͘ɺલ ஈͷ/HJOYΈ͍ͯΔ w '1.ͷඪ४ΤϥʔΛݕͯ͠ɺ/HJOYଆͰͦͷࢫ ͷΤϥʔϩάΛग़ྗ͢ΔͷͰɺॏϩάʹͳΔ
ϫʔΧʔͷΤϥʔϩάΛ'1. ຊମͷඪ४ग़ྗʹૹͬͯΈΔ 1)1'1. XPSLFS XPSLFS XPSLFS '1.ͷॲཧɺ࣮ࡍʹϫʔ Χʔ͕࣮ࢪ͍ͯ͠Δ ࣮ࡍʹϫʔΧʔͷඪ४Τϥʔ͕1)1'1.ͷඪ४ Τϥʔʹసૹ͞Εͯɺϩά͕࠾औ͞Ε͍ͯΔ
w '1.ͷϫʔΧʔ͕ΤϥʔΛग़ྗͨ͠ΒɺͦΕΛ'1. ͷຊମ͕ࣗͷඪ४Τϥʔʹग़ྗ͍ͯ͠Δ w ͜͜Ͱɺ'1.͕ඪ४Τϥʔʹग़͍ͯ͠Δͷ͕ѱ͍ͱ ߟ͑ɺϫʔΧʔͷΤϥʔΛຊମͷඪ४ग़ྗʹग़͢͜ ͱΛߟ͑Δ w EPDLFSDPOGͱ͍͏ઃఆϑΝΠϧͰɺϩάपΓͷઃ ఆΛ͍ͯ͠Δ༷
EPDLFSDPOG VTSMPDBMFUDQIQGQNEEPDLFSDPOG ͜͜Λʹͨ͠Βඪ४ग़ྗʹసૹ͞ΕΔʁ ͱͯෆԺͳจݴ͕͋Δ ࣮ࡍɺϩάԿग़ͳ͘ͳΔ
ώϯτʹͳΓͦ͏ͳͷ '1.ʹग़ྗ͞Ε͍ͯΔϩά /HJOYͷϩά '1.ͷ͡Ίͷϩά ΞΫηεϩά ग़ྗ͞Εͳ͍
ͱΓ͋͑ͣ'1.ͷϩάΛ෧͡ Δํ๏ w ϩάϨϕϧͷ੍ݶΛFNFSHҎ্ʹ͢Δͱɺ'1.ͷϩά ΤϥʔϩάʹྲྀΕͳ͘ͳΔ w OHJOYͷFSSPSϨϕϧͷϩάྲྀΕͳ͘ͳΔ
ϕετϓϥΫςΟε ͳΜͩΖ͏ͳʁ
ݱࡏͷঢ়ଶ w ͱΓ͋͑ͣɺΞϓϦ͔Βग़ͨϩά/HJOYʹग़Δ ঢ়گΛڐ༰ ΞΫηεͦΜͳʹଟ͘ͳ͍ͷͰෛ୲ʹ ͳΒͳ͍ w ΞϓϦͷΦϦδφϧͷϩά'1.ͷ༨ܭͳใ͕ ೖΔͱѻ͍ʹ͍͘ͷͰɺFMBTUJDTFBSDIʹ͛
͍ͯΔ
ߟ͍͑ͯΔରࡦ w /HJOYͷΤϥʔϩάΛग़͞ͳ͍ 1)1ʹܨ͍ͩ࣌ඪ४ΤϥʔΛग़͞ͳ͍ͱ͔ઃ ఆͰ͖ͦ͏ w ΞΫηεϩάͰ/HJOYͷΤϥʔϩάʹݕ͞Εͳ ͍ཧ༝Λ୳ͬͯΈΔ '1.ͷιʔεಡ·ͳ͍ͱͩΊ͔
͝ਗ਼ௌ͋Γ͕ͱ͏͟͝ ͍·͢